TERM环境变量未设置是什么意思



我是python的新手,我试图清除控制台,但收到消息"TERM environment variable not set"。我在网上找到了解决这个问题的方法,但我找不到它实际含义的解释。

$TERM是一个环境变量,这意味着它由操作系统维护,并在程序之间共享,而不仅仅属于您自己的程序。

在这种情况下,$TERM表示程序运行的终端类型。例如,当我在终端中运行echo $TERM时,我会得到xterm-256color作为输出。据推测,您使用的clear命令会检查正在使用的终端,以便了解如何清除该终端(因为不同的终端可能会以不同的方式进行清除(。

最新更新